WebMar 1, 2024 · class mutex; (since C++11) The mutex class is a synchronization primitive that can be used to protect shared data from being simultaneously accessed by multiple threads. mutex offers exclusive, non-recursive ownership semantics: A calling thread owns a mutex from the time that it successfully calls either lock or try_lock until it calls unlock . Webstd::unique_lock:: release. release. Breaks the association of the associated mutex, if any, and *this. No locks are unlocked. If *this held ownership of the associated mutex prior to the call, the caller is now responsible to unlock the mutex. WebLocks all the objects passed as arguments, blocking the calling thread if necessary. The function locks the objects using an unspecified sequence of calls to their members lock, try_lock and unlock that ensures that all arguments are locked on return (without producing any deadlocks).
